The Anode Rod

H2o heaters are primarily metal tanks with vitreous glass bonded on the inside of to protect the steel from rust. This sounds good but you will find normally seams and fittings that leave some steel uncovered to your drinking water. This is why h2o heater manufacturers install a sacrificial anode rod from the tank.

An anode rod shields the exposed steel with the effects of electrolysis. Electrolysis takes place when dissimilar metals are involved with each other in h2o. Whichever steel is considered the most reactive will corrode to start with. A metal's "reactivity" is calculated on a thing called a galvanic scale.

Anode rods are made of aluminum or magnesium, that happen to be a lot more reactive than steel, so that they will corrode first. This sacrificial rod shields the metal inside the tank from corrosion. But, due to the fact they're developed to wear down, anode rods should be replaced when depleted. Just how long this requires is dependent on various components, these types of as drinking water top quality, temperature and utilization styles. At the time the anode rod is used, up the tank starts off corroding.

All new water heaters should have an anode rod put in from the factory. A few of them provide the anode set up in a very individual opening in addition to the tank and some use a mixture anode rod which is mounted in the incredibly hot drinking water outlet in the tank. If possible, have a water heater having a separate anode rod, which is able to usually possess a hex head on leading exactly where the anode screws into the tank. This could allow you to increase a 2nd, mixture anode to extend your protection.

Introducing a second anode when putting in or servicing a h2o heater is a really cost effective approach to prolong the life of the tank. That is essentially just what the brands do for his or her for a longer time warrantied models. You can do the identical matter. For those who incorporate that using a normal upkeep regimen you could increase several years to the water heater's company existence.

Drain The Tank At the least Once A Calendar year

Retaining your h2o heater does not have to generally be an enormous chore possibly. Each and every h2o heater manual at any time published incorporates a part about upkeep. They all say to examine the T&P valve and drain the heater at the least annually. In the event you have at any time done those things you might have found out the T&P Valve wouldn't close properly after checking it and the h2o heater drain valve now leaks. Lots of people had a similar experience and decided it wasn't worth the hassle.

While it is true which the T&P Valve is likely to leak after testing it, the danger involved if it failed makes the risk of a leak worth it. Should you want to see what could potentially happen due to a failed T&P, just Google "water heater blast" and check out the video at the website of that name. It will make replacing a $6 part a no-brainer. It only usually takes a little residential plumbing how to skill and a few minutes.

A single other issue you can do when you set up or assistance a drinking water heater to make your existence simpler is to go ahead and exchange the cheesy, plastic drain valve. You can do this really simply when the tank is dry. You may use a brass boiler drain or hose bibb, just make sure it is prolonged enough to reach the tank through the insulation and housing. The absolute best way I've seen is to use a brass nipple, a threaded ball valve and an adapter from pipe threads to hose threads with a cap screwed on the hose threads to prevent accidentally opening the valve.

After you've put in a real drain valve, follow the producers suggestion. Once or twice a yr, hook a hose for the drain and flush the tank out until the drinking water runs clear. This could help prevent a sediment build up from the tank bottom. Sediment that collects around the bottom seam can act as a barrier and not make it possible for the anode to protect that part from the tank. A reduction in efficiency due to this build up is also a frequent gas h2o heater problem, but the significant issue is that it blocks the anode safety.

It is also a excellent idea to check the anode when you flush the heater, for those who make this a plan you will be able to replace the anode before it is completely gone. Remember, at the time the anode is gone the tank commences corroding. With the water into the drinking water heater turned off, take a big wrench and remove the hex nut along with the h2o heater. The anode need to look sort of like a chewed up stick, this usually means it is working. If it is extremely small or looks pretty much like a wire with some chunks on it, it needs for being replaced.
